(12-02-2021, 08:13 AM)Greg Wrote: Under the Helmet: The legacy of Boba Fett
In the run up to the Boba Fest release, Disney+ has a documentary about the history of Boba Fett. It was quite interesting to see how Mr. Fett started and who played him over the years. It's amazing this minor character has grown and thrived over 40 years. It's worth a watch to catch you up on Boba Fett.
That was better than I expected. I expected a teaser ad. And it was that. But there was a lot of history I didn’t know even though, like all of us, we bore witness to his creation.
I remember being disappointed by Boba in the original trilogy. All this hype and he falls in the Sarlaak? Then the prequel trilogy was just annoying. Now decades later, he’s finally come around.
